Transaction 485590f721b30ba5ee577e0efe2d890743877341de8e4cb321d4c28fae8941fa
1 Input
1 Output
-
485590f721b30ba5ee577e0efe2d890743877341de8e4cb321d4c28fae8941fa:0
- value
- 21123488
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e9b7080f566da295cc3e916075ac6bed781d65b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12LEfow6YUQdKTWkDiC2D9GtDCB3wwy55k